| 1 | Growth and Repair Potential of Three Species of Bacteria in Reclaimed Wastewater after UV Disinfection显示文摘Objective The growth and repair potential of three typical microorganisms in reclaimed water after UV disinfection was investigated to assess the effects of photo-reactivation and dark repair of microorganisms,and the microbial safety of reclaimed water following this procedure.Methods The growth and repair potential of Escherichia coli,a fecal coliform strain and Bacillus subtilis in the effluent of a biological wastewater treatment plant disinfected by a low-pressure UV lamp were investigated.Results Any increase in bacterial numbers in the effluent after UV disinfection was due to damage repair.Exposure to photo-reactivating light for 8-10 h after UV irradiation with a dose of 5 mJ/cm 2,the highest percentage of photo-reactivation observed for E.coli and the fecal coliform strain was 29% and 15% respectively.B.subtilis showed little photo-reactivation under these conditions.The percentage of photo-reactivation was related to the UV dose and the photo-reactivating time,and a function was developed to forecast the final concentrations of E.coli and the fecal coliform strain after UV disinfection with possible photo-reactivation.Conclusion Different species of bacteria displayed different responses to UV light and different repair potentials.The repair of indigenous bacteria in wastewater needs to be investigated in future work. | GUO MeiTing HUANG JingJing HU HongYing LIU WenJun | 2011 | Biomedical and Environmental Sciences2011,24,4: | 8 |
| 2 | PI3K/Akt/mTOR signaling orchestrates the phenotypic transition and chemo-resistance of small cell lung cancer显示文摘Small cell lung cancer(SCLC)is a phenotypically heterogeneous disease with an extremely poor prognosis,which is mainly attributed to the rapid development of resistance to chemotherapy.However,the relation between the growth phenotypes and chemo-resistance of SCLC remains largely unclear.Through comprehensive bioinformatic analyses,we found that the heterogeneity of SCLC phenotype was significantly associated with different sensitivity to chemotherapy.Adherent or semiadherent SCLC cells were enriched with activation of the PI3K/Akt/mTOR pathway and were highly chemoresistant.Mechanistically,activation of the PI3K/Akt/mTOR pathway promotes the phenotypic transition from suspension to adhesion growth pattern and confers SCLC cells with chemo-resistance.Such chemo-resistance could be largely overcome by combining chemotherapy with PI3K/Akt/mTOR pathway inhibitors.Our findings support that the PI3K/Akt/mTOR pathway plays an important role in SCLC phenotype transition and chemo-resistance,which holds important clinical implications for improving SCLC treatment. | Xuefeng Li Cheng Li Chenchen Guo Qiqi Zhao Jiayu Cao Hsin-Yi Huang Meiting Yue Yun Xue Yujuan Jin Liang Hu Hongbin Ji | 2021 | Journal of Genetics and Genomics2021,48,7: | 5 |
| 3 | Ultra-thin metal-organic framework nanoribbons显示文摘Structure engineering of metal-organic frameworks(MOFs)at the nanometer scale is attracting increasing interest due to their unique properties and new functions that normally cannot be achieved in bulk MOF crystals.Here,we report the preparation of ultra-thin MOF nanoribbons(NRBs)by using metal-hydroxide nanostructures as the precursors.Importantly,this general method can be used to synthesize various kinds of ultra-thin MOF NRBs,such as MBDC(M=Co,Ni;BDC=1,4-benzenedicarboxylate),NiCoBDC,CoTCPP(TCPP=tetrakis(4-carboxyphenyl)porphyrin)and MIL-53(Al)NRBs.As a proof-of-concept application,the as-prepared ultra-thin Co BDC NRBs have been successfully used as a fluorescent sensing platform for DNA detection,which exhibited excellent sensitivity and selectivity.The present strategy might open an avenue to prepare MOF nanomaterials with new structures and unique properties for various promising applications. | Bingqing Wang Meiting Zhao Liuxiao Li Ying Huang Xiao Zhang Chong Guo Zhicheng Zhang Hongfei Cheng Wenxian Liu Jing Shang Jing Jin Xiaoming Sun Junfeng Liu Hua Zhang | 2020 | National Science Review2020,7,1: | 1 |
| 4 | Review of preferentially selective lithium extraction from spent lithium batteries: Principle and performance显示文摘Lithium,as the lightest and lowest potential metal,is an ideal 'battery metal' and the core strategic metal of the new energy industry revolution.Recovering lithium from spent lithium batteries(LIBs)has become one of the significant approaches to obtaining lithium resources.At present,the lithium extraction being generally placed at the last step of the spent LIBs recovery process has puzzles such as high acid consumption,low Li recovery purity and low recovery efficiency.Selective lithium extraction at the first step of the recovery process can effectively solve those puzzles.Since lithium leaching is a non-spontaneous reaction requiring additional energy to achieve,it is found that these methods can be divided into five ways according to the different types of energy driving the reaction occurring:(ⅰ)electric energy driving lithium extraction;(ⅱ) chemical energy driving lithium extraction;(ⅲ) mechanical energy driving lithium extraction;(ⅳ) thermal energy driving lithium extraction;(ⅴ) other energy driving lithium extraction.Through the analysis of the principle,reaction process and results of recovering lithium methods can provide a few directions for scholars’ subsequent research.It is necessary to speed up the exploration of the principle of these methods.It is expected that this study could provide a reference for the research on the selective lithium extraction. | Zhe Gao Meiting Huang Liming Yang Yufa Feng Yuan Ding Penghui Shao Xubiao Luo | 2023 | Journal of Energy Chemistry2023,,3: | 1 |
| 5 | Modified R-CODOX-M/IVAC chemotherapy regimens in Chinese patients with untreated sporadic Burkitt lymphoma显示文摘Objective:To characterize modified R-CODOX-M/IVAC-based chemotherapy to lower the severe adverse events in Chinese adult patients with sporadic Burkitt lymphoma.Methods:We enrolled a retrospective cohort including 123 adult patients with untreated sporadic Burkitt lymphoma from August 2008 to September 2019 at Sun Yat-sen University Cancer Center.We studied a dose-modified and long-course R-CODOX-M/IVAC regimen utilizing a low dose of 1.0 g/m2/cycle cyclophosphamide,2 g/m2/cycle methotrexate,4,500 mg/m2/cycle ifosfamide,and 4.0 g/m2/cycle cytarabine.Forty-nine patients with low risk disease underwent 4–6 cycles of dose-modified R-CODOX-M-based chemotherapy.Seventy-four patients with high risk disease underwent 6–8 cycles of dose-modified alternating R-CODOX-M/IVAC regimens.Results:The objective remission was 87.0%.The event-free survival rate and overall survival at 3 years were 81.2%and 92.1%,respectively.Major grade 3–4 adverse events included leukopenia(91.9%),anemia(58.5%),thrombocytopenia(73.2%),and febrile neutropenia(48.8%).A total of 26.0%and 37.4%of patients received red blood cell and platelet transfusions,respectively.We observed 4 cases(3.3%)of septic shock after chemotherapy.Two treatment-related deaths occurred from severe infection.Conclusions:The modified R-CODOX-M/IVAC chemotherapy regimen was effective for sporadic Burkitt lymphoma in the Chinese population,with a lower toxicity than standard regimens. | Meiting Chen Zhao Wang Xiaojie Fang Yuyi Yao Quanguang Ren Zegeng Chen Ying Tian Fei Pan Xiaoqian Li Zhiming Li Qingqing Cai He Huang Tongyu Lin | 2021 | Cancer Biology & Medicine2021,18,3: | 0 |
